Madtsoia lived from the Late Cretaceous to the Eocene, approximately 90 to 40 million years ago. This giant snake belongs to the extinct family Madtsoiidae, an archaic group of Gondwanan snakes representing one of the oldest lineages of large constricting snakes. Madtsoiids were a cosmopolitan family across Gondwanan continents — South America, Africa, India, Madagascar, and Australia — before being supplanted by modern boids and pythonids. Madtsoia survived the Cretaceous-Paleogene mass extinction that eliminated the dinosaurs, persisting until the Eocene before finally disappearing.
Madtsoia bai, the type and largest species, is estimated at approximately 5 to 7 meters in length, making it one of the largest snakes of the dinosaur era and early Cenozoic. Some fossil vertebrae suggest the largest individuals may have approached 9 meters. Its maximum body diameter was approximately 20 to 30 centimeters. Although smaller than the famous Titanoboa (13 meters) which lived a few million years later, Madtsoia was nonetheless a formidably-sized snake, comparable to the largest modern pythons and anacondas.
Madtsoia was a large constricting snake that killed prey by constriction — wrapping its muscular coils around victims until asphyxiation. Its diet probably included primitive mammals, small dinosaurs (during the Cretaceous), birds, lizards, and other reptiles. A spectacular discovery in India revealed a fossil of Sanajeh indicus, a closely related madtsoiid, coiled around titanosaur eggs and a baby sauropod — proving these snakes actually fed on baby dinosaurs. After the dinosaurs' disappearance, Madtsoia probably turned to the rapidly diversifying mammals of the Eocene.
Madtsoia inhabited various terrestrial environments across the Gondwanan continents during the Late Cretaceous and into the early Cenozoic. The type species M. bai was described from Argentina, but related species or forms have been identified in India (M. pisdurensis), Madagascar, North Africa, and Australia, demonstrating a remarkably wide Gondwanan distribution. During the Cretaceous period, these continents were still relatively close to each other, allowing the dispersal of the family across connected or nearby landmasses. Depositional environments include tropical forests, alluvial plains, and coastal zones. In Argentina, fossils come from Cretaceous and Eocene formations of Patagonia, representing temperate to subtropical forest environments with abundant prey resources.
Madtsoia anatomy is known primarily from vertebrae and some cranial elements, as fossil snakes rarely fossilize in complete articulation. Its vertebrae are characteristic of madtsoiids: wide, robust, with a distinct dorsal depression (zygosphene-zygantrum) and well-developed articular surfaces. Like all madtsoiids, Madtsoia possessed a tooth-bearing premaxillary bone — a primitive trait lost in modern snakes, which have an edentulous premaxilla. This feature, combined with other basal traits, places madtsoiids among the most primitive known snakes. Its body was cylindrical and muscular, adapted for constriction.
Madtsoia was probably a terrestrial constrictor, hunting by ambush in the undergrowth of Gondwanan forests. Like large modern pythons and boas, it probably waited concealed in vegetation or near water sources for prey to pass nearby, before striking rapidly and wrapping its coils around the victim. The discovery of the madtsoiid Sanajeh coiled around a titanosaur nest suggests these snakes frequented dinosaur nesting sites to feed on hatchlings — a nest predation behavior similar to modern pythons targeting crocodile and bird nests.
Madtsoia was described in 1933 by Argentine paleontologist George Gaylord Simpson from fossil vertebrae discovered in Patagonia, Argentina. The name honors an Argentine fossil locality. The type species is M. bai, but several other species have been described: M. pisdurensis (India), M. laurasiae (Spain), and other fragmentary forms from Africa and Australia. The family Madtsoiidae, to which it belongs, is one of the oldest known snake families, with representatives from the Middle Cretaceous to the Eocene, and even the Pleistocene in Australia (Wonambi). The 2010 discovery of Sanajeh indicus, found coiled around dinosaur eggs in India, spectacularly illustrated this family's ecology.
